Advanced Diploma in Project ManagementThe Advanced Professional Diploma in Project Management is an internationally recognized programme that is designed for those who are involved in, or aspiring to, project management at project manager or key specialist level, and who wish to be recognized as an expert in this field. The programme is also an ideal preparation course for professional managers and specialists seeking to move on to a Masters Level qualification, in Project Management, Quality Management, or Strategic Management. Accreditation Body INTER-CEPT Diploma is recognized internationally and its qualifications are accepted by employers and higher education establishments throughout the world, and by professional associations such as the PMI and APM. Content A course comprises 8 mandatory modules. CEP901: Module 1: Advanced Professional Development Assessing Needs and Planning Professional Development CEP901: Module 2: Contarcts and Procurement for Projects Political Influence and Conflict; CEP901: Module 3: Planning and Scheduling Project Activity Planning Work Activity and Outcomes; Cost Accurately; Project Scheduling Techniques; CEP901: Module 4: Winnning Teams (focus on Project Teams) Characteristics of Teams; Methods of Team Development; Monitoring and Evaluating Team Performance CEP901: Module 5: Implementation, Monitoring and Control of Project Activity Implementing the Plan; CEP901: Module 6: Review and Evaluation of Project Performance Review and Evaluation of Financial Criteria and CEP901: Module 7: Leadership (focus on Leading Projects) The impact of different leadership attributes and skills on the project; CEP901: Module 8: Management Rsearch - Project and Presentation Research project - Planning the development of a new product, service or process and presenting proposals All 8 modules must be successfully completed to gain the award.
